    Cultural and economic shifts fuel this interest. As live-work-feed travel blends with affordable living trends, locals often know the insider routes—dark-horse rental companies, fleet partnerships tied to neighborhoods, or niche platforms unseen by mainstream apps. Simultaneously, millennials and Gen Z increasingly prioritize experiences over luxury, seeking transportation that feels authentic and integrates seamlessly with daily life. This has amplified demand for lesser-known rental models offering unique access outside standard car-sharing or corporate fleets.
